DIY Troubleshooting

Before calling for service, try these quick checks:

  • 1
    Ensure all supply vents are open and unblocked
  • 2
    Check for furniture blocking airflow to rooms
  • 3
    Verify thermostat location is not affected by drafts or sunlight
  • 4
    Feel for weak airflow at vents in problem rooms
  • 5
    Check if problem rooms are at end of long duct runs

How We Diagnose Uneven Temperatures

To effectively diagnose uneven temperatures, our technicians at West Bay HVAC follow a systematic approach. First, they conduct a thorough inspection of your HVAC system, including the thermostat settings and ductwork. They will check for any visible leaks or blockages in the ducts that could be causing temperature variations. Next, they evaluate the insulation in your home, as poor insulation can lead to significant heat loss or gain. Using advanced diagnostic tools, they measure airflow and temperature in various rooms to pinpoint the root cause of the issue.

Solutions for Uneven Temperatures in Riverview

Once the underlying issues contributing to uneven temperatures are identified, several solutions may be offered. Common repair options include sealing duct leaks, adjusting or replacing thermostats, and optimizing airflow by balancing the duct system. In some cases, adding insulation or upgrading to a multi-zone system may be recommended to improve overall comfort. Our technicians will discuss the best solutions tailored to your specific needs, ensuring your home achieves an even temperature throughout.

Preventing Uneven Temperatures in Riverview

Preventing uneven temperatures in your home requires regular maintenance and proactive measures. First, ensure that supply vents are not blocked or closed, as this can restrict airflow. Additionally, schedule annual HVAC tune-ups to keep your system running efficiently and to catch potential issues early. Consider using programmable thermostats to better manage temperature settings in different areas of your home. Lastly, check insulation levels and seal any gaps to prevent heat loss or gain, enhancing the overall efficiency of your HVAC system.
